Continental Loan. October 11, 1787. $9 Federal Indent. PMG Very Fine 30.,No. H6B 3431. Signed by Hardy. These scarce notes were issued from 1782 to 1787 in order for the young post-war government to attempt to repay its debts. These were receivable for taxes and came in denominations sometimes in the nineteenths of a dollar. The present note is moderately circulated with just some pinholes seen as noted by the grading service.,,
